CNC Machining FAQ

What to confirm before we quote your parts.

Which file formats should I send?

Send a 3D CAD file such as STEP together with a dimensioned 2D drawing when tolerances, threads, finishes or inspection points need to be controlled.

Which materials can you machine?

Common projects use aluminum, stainless steel, carbon steel, brass, copper and engineering plastics. Final availability is confirmed against the drawing and order quantity.

Can you support both prototypes and production quantities?

Yes. The machining route is planned around the current quantity and the likelihood of repeat orders so the project can scale without losing revision control.

What tolerances can you achieve?

Tolerance capability depends on part size, geometry, material, datum strategy and inspection method. Mark critical tolerances on the drawing so they can be reviewed before quotation.
